First and foremost, no matter information you explicitly share with a relationship app or website, the platform now has it. Depending on the platform you’re using, that may mean your gender, sexual orientation, location information, political affiliation, and faith. If you’re sharing photos or videos via a relationship app, yes, the company has entry to these. And they may be screening them with AI too; Bumble makes use of such tech to preemptively screen and block pictures that could be lewd.

Those who have ever paid to make use of courting sites or apps report more constructive experiences than those that have never paid. Around six-in-ten paid users (58%) say their personal experiences with courting sites or apps have been positive; half of users who have by no means paid say this.
